In an Amputee Clinic, Putting on a Happy Face

In an Amputee Clinic, Putting on a Happy Face


Adele Levine, a former physical therapist in the amputee clinic at Walter Reed, writes that caring for wounded soldiers at the height of the Iraq and Afghan wars felt overwhelming at times. But she says clinic life was also happy, and surprisingly, funny.
